Caution: Inspect Your Bow Hunting Gear Before Heading Out


Summary

As a bow hunter, it's essential to ensure your equipment is in prime condition before heading into the field. Equipment doesn't last forever, so a thorough check is crucial.

Key Points to Consider


Inspect Your Bow

The bow is often where most issues arise, so it should be your starting point. Instead of a cursory glance, check the strings for any wear or corrosion. If they need replacing, do so promptly and apply wax. Examine the kisser button, peep sight, and nock points; replace anything that doesn't look perfect. Avoid the risk of using defective gear.

If you notice any rust, clean it off meticulously. Use dry graphite lubricant on all moving parts, especially pivot points like a pendulum. Check your string silencers and replace them if necessary. Ensure your quiver is securely mounted and holds your arrows firmly ?" it shouldn't move around while hunting.

Check the Details

Examine the hood of the broadheads and replace any worn or unusable guide rods. Ensure your bow's finish is intact to maintain proper camouflage. Use tape to cover any glaring spots.

Look for cracks or fissures in the bow's limbs. Anything unusual needs attention to prevent injury. Inspect your arm guard, strap, and buckles. If you use a release aid, make sure it's in good condition. A release can enhance accuracy by promoting relaxation.

Maintain Your Blades

Dull blades should be sharpened. While having sharp blades increases efficiency, it's also crucial for the humane aspect of hunting. A quick, clean kill reduces animal suffering.

Final Steps for Arrows

Finally, inspect your arrows. Replace any that are warped or bent, as they're essential to both the art of archery and a successful hunt.

By ensuring every component is in top shape, you align with the ethical standards of hunting and enhance the overall experience. Happy hunting!
